A daytime scene depicts a parade or procession on a city street in Surabaya, Indonesia. In the foreground and midground, members of a drum corps from POLTEKPEL SURABAYA, as indicated on their instruments, march from left to right. They wear light brown/khaki uniforms, black boots, and varying headwear, including a large brown bird-themed costume and tall black hats with white plumes. Each participant carries a large white bass drum, branded "Reims," decorated with black and yellow fabric bearing the institution's name and crest. Some also wear blue sashes or capes. In the background, behind a dark metal barrier, a crowd of spectators, consisting of adults and children, observes the event. A vendor among the spectators holds a tray with multiple cups of what appears to be corn. Behind the spectators and trees, commercial buildings line the street. A prominent red "CIRCLE K" sign is visible on a white building, and further down, a sign reading "ETANDAN" (Kampung Wisata Etandan) is seen. Several individuals in police or security uniforms are present among the onlookers and further along the parade route. The street surface is paved asphalt.
